← Back to team overview

sslug-teknik team mailing list archive

Re: Php og baggrundsbilleder

 

Hej Brix

Tak for forslaget:


Henrik Brix Andersen skriver:Så er det fordi, din path bliver ændret, når
formen kalder $PHP_SELF.

> (Burde du forøvrigt ikke angive en method=?)
>

$PHP_SELF er i situation b  :/php3/php3.exe/myweb/mypage.php3

Så det er rigtignok at pathen er blevet ændret, da den jo før var
http://127.0.01/myweb/mypage.php3.

Det jeg ikke forstår er, at et relativ link som  i a-situationen er <A
HREF="mypage2.php3" /A>,
af php automatisk bliver ændret til
http://127.0.0.1/php3/php.exe/myweb/mypage2.php3, mens den relative
reference
til baggrundsbilledet 'BACKGROUND = read-filer/bkg.jpe' ikke bliver ændret
af php i situation b.

'method' er sat til post.

Det jeg gerne vil undgå, er at skrive absolutte stier i scriptet, som  efter
udviklingsfasen
skal ændres i forhold til scriptets endelige placering på en webserver.

mvh

Søren Larsen



>
> Jeg har et php-script som indeholder en form med tagget:
> > <FORM method = POST action="<?php echo $PHP_SELF ?> " >
> > <BODY>-tagget indeholder bla.a. 'BACKGROUND = read-filer/bkg.jpe'
>
> Prøv at skrive værdien af $PHP_SELF ud, og se hvad den er...
>
> echo $PHP_SELF
>
> Mvh
> //Brix
>

Follow ups

References